Vadodara, Gujarat: Parul University and Zydex Group have recently collaborated to introduce Bachelor’s and Master’s programmes in Bio Farming, designed to shape the future of sustainable organic agriculture in India. The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) is solidifying the collaboration between Parul University, renowned for its academic excellence, and Zydex Group.

Speaking on the occasion, Dr. Ajay Ranka, CMD, Zydex Group said, “Zydex is committed to enabling farmers to produce nutritious, safe, and affordable food for all. Our pioneering bio farming technique that eliminates the use of chemical fertilisers and crop protection chemicals along with higher yields with lower water consumption from the first crop cycle itself, has already demonstrated its effectiveness in real-world fields. Through the signing of this MoU with Parul University, we aim to nurture a new generation of passionate and brilliant agro-scientists dedicated to leading India into an organic future.”

Dr. Parul Patel, Vice President, Parul University, said on the collaboration, “This MoU with Zydex marks a pivotal step towards bridging the gap between academic and practical agricultural knowledge and solidifies our efforts in providing our students with the necessary skills and expertise in the ever-growing field of bio farming and sustainable agriculture. We look forward to the exciting journey that lies ahead as we work together to launch and develop these transformative Bio Farming courses.”

“A strong industry-academia partnership is the need of the hour as it is instrumental in advancing research and creating a skilled workforce. This MOU between FGI (Federation of Gujarat Industries) members – Zydex Group and Parul University has the potential to contribute to the betterment of both – industries and universities. It will help create graduates who have the know-how of the industry that they will work in and create better future employees. We are quite hopeful that this is just the beginning of many more such partnerships between various other industries and universities,” said Tarak Patel, President, FGI.

The 4-year Bachelor’s and 2-year Master’s courses are slated to run for a minimum of 10 batches, offering a comprehensive education in the field. The admission process is stringent, targeting candidates with B.Sc. degrees in Biotechnology, Biochemistry, Botany, Zoology, Microbiology, Molecular Biology, Genetics, or related fields, with rigorous scrutiny, entrance exams, and personal interviews.

The curriculum blends theoretical coursework with hands-on field training, demanding high levels of discipline and commitment from students, under guidelines set by both Zydex Group and Parul University.

To incentivise participation, admitted students will receive monthly scholarships (Rs. 10,000 for Bachelor’s and Rs. 12,500 for Master’s) for the entire duration of the course, contingent upon signing an undertaking to work with Zydex for 11 months upon course completion. Examinations will be conducted following Parul University’s regulations, with fieldwork assessments overseen by a panel consisting of mentors from Zydex Group and Parul University faculty members.
